From a sector perspective, CPAC operates within Peru’s construction materials industry, which is influenced by macroeconomic factors such as infrastructure spending, residential construction demand, and the cost of inputs like energy and raw materials. Recent government announcements regarding public works projects could provide a tailwind for cement demand, though the pace of execution remains uncertain. Additionally, fluctuations in the Peruvian sol against the U.S. dollar may impact CPAC’s reported earnings, given its local revenue base. Without a clear sector-wide breakout, CPAC’s price action remains tied to company-specific developments and broader economic trends. CPAC’s price chart currently shows the stock trading in a defined range between the $9.99 support level and the $11.05 resistance zone. Repeated tests of these boundaries without a decisive breakout often form a consolidation pattern that can precede a more substantial move. From a technical perspective, a relative strength index (RSI) reading in the neutral range—likely around 45–55—indicates that the stock is neither overbought nor oversold, leaving room for movement in either direction. Short-term moving averages, such as the 50-day or 20-day, may be converging around the $10.50 area, which could act as a pivot point. The price action over the past several sessions has been characterized by small intraday ranges and limited follow-through on rallies, suggesting a lack of momentum. A sustained move above $11.05 would represent a breakout from the range and could signal renewed bullish interest, while a drop below $9.99 might indicate weakening support. Volume patterns will be key: a breakout on high volume would add credibility, whereas a low-volume move could prove false. Looking ahead, CPAC’s future price direction may hinge on several factors. If the stock manages to break above the $11.05 resistance level on above-average volume, it could test higher levels near $11.50 or $12.00, depending on the strength of the move. Conversely, a decline below $9.99 could open the path toward the next support area, possibly around $9.50 or lower. The upcoming earnings report could act as a major catalyst; solid results or optimistic forward guidance might prompt a rally, while a miss could trigger a selloff. Additionally, macroeconomic conditions in Peru—such as changes in interest rates, inflation trends, or fiscal policy—may influence cement demand and CPAC’s profitability. Company-specific news, including new project wins, capacity expansions, or shifts in input costs, are also worth monitoring. Because CPAC is a relatively low-volatility stock, significant price moves might require a confluence of positive or negative factors rather than a single data point. Traders and investors should watch how the stock reacts at the $9.99 and $11.05 levels in the coming sessions, as a clean breakout above or below could signal the start of a new trend.
